quote: Complete contridiction there :look: The way how it works is: BB5 handsets have had a security upgrade, if you want it unlocked you need to contact the network the phone is locked too. Voda can only unlock voda, orange can only unlock orange. Now this is usually country specific also, eg UK orange cant unlock France Orange phones. Each network is given a smartcard which is required to calculate these codes when inserted into official nokia equipment (which aint cheap). This is why they can do them. Its not like dct4 where nokia equipment avaliable at service centres could rebuild the simlock information. The people who make the unlocking equipment 99% of the time copy nokias ideas, files, algorythms etc etc. This is why no one has cracked the unlocking on bb5, as there is nothing for them to copy. Service centres can easilly "loose" equipment for developers, but networks dont let such things happen.
